Ingredients For biscuits from scratch

  • 2 1/2 c
    self-rising flour
  • 1 1/2 tsp
    baking powder
  • 1 1/2 tsp
    sugar
  • dash
    of salt
  • 4 Tbsp
    shortening (do not melt)
  • 1 c
    *buttermilk, room temperature

How To Make biscuits from scratch

  • 1
    Preheat oven to 475. Mix flour, baking powder, sugar and salt together and combine well. Make a hole in center of flour mixture and add in the shortening. Gradually add in the buttermilk mixing with a fork to break up the shortening. Now start combining well with hands until dough comes together and is smooth.
  • 2
    Pinch off and roll in hands and place (biscuits touching) on greased cooking stone (or pan). Press down with knuckles a bit. Bake at 475 for approximately 10-12 minutes or until desired browness.
  • 3
    Note: Any solid shortening is fine to use, even the butter crisco. In these biscuits I used Lou Ana Coconut Oil, which is actually solid shortening. *You may have to add a little more buttermilk if needed.
